Output ee741a632bbeb507e18c67ebf9258b80e335de53e376e21d9daf17db0a801b9a:5

value
2626572
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f6faca01958211b71b9f2b99cfc78b8893efb665 OP_EQUALVERIFY OP_CHECKSIG
address
1PWufKeZ6dVEWCDJFSm788Y5VAKK3zs1A7
transaction
ee741a632bbeb507e18c67ebf9258b80e335de53e376e21d9daf17db0a801b9a
spent
true